Before the economic downturn, the real estate business featured amongst the booming areas of the economy. People still see this industry as one that is financially rewarding lucrative despite the economic tumble. Because of this, folks are very much willing to risk by investing in this line of business. For a person to become successful at this trade, he or she has to get real estate coaching and training first.
Newcomers in this industry normally have two paths to follow so to start out. First, they may start slowly in the industry by engaging in small property sales before going into big deals. Secondly, they may seek out property owners within the market so as to get an idea of how the market is.
For new players the field is very tricky. The field largely deals heavy monetary investments. Unscrupulous dealers preying on untrained beginners are very many in this field. It thus becomes advisable to hire a trainer to coach you on how to maneuver around. Preferably, the trainer ought to be from an agency that coaches beginners. This is a cornerstone to becoming successful dealer of properties.
It is very clear that getting professional coaching can actually make a normal person to become really successful agent in the field. Since professional agencies also do hire the services of these trainers to coach their agents is a fact that emphasizes this point. However, the economic meltdown resulted in these companies reversing the practice. Most of the agencies totally stopped training their stuff.
This is a field that is commonly compared to chess game, with the investor viewed as the game player. Having a clear objective in mind, much like the chess player, a realty agent has got have deep knowledge of strategies and maneuvers of financing and investing in this industry. The basic rules and tricks are things that can be taught by these trainers.
The trainer understands the goals of his client really well. He provides the client a clear understanding of the pros and cons of investing, taking loans, and buying or selling property. After the client identifies an area they are interest in, the coach may chalk out a strategic plan that will be most profitable for the client. However, the client is responsible for the investments.
At this point one may be tempted to ask themselves if there is need to for counsel from these coaches. The first thing to know is that, many starting agents, ordinary property owners and first time investors usually find it really hard to understand market dynamics. Classroom knowledge or seeking advice from brokers does not help much. Due to these circumstances, expert advice from the coaches becomes really crucial.
The current reality is that human population is rising globally. What this means is that the need for realty services is crucial if everybody is to get a roof over them, whether a home or business property among many others. The central position of real estate coaching and training in enabling this shows the importance of this service.
